Are people in Medford older or younger than people in Haddon Heights?
- The Median Age in Medford is 6.5 years older than in Haddon Heights.

Are housing costs cheaper in Medford or Haddon Heights?
- Medford housing costs are 28.5% more expensive than Haddon Heights hous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Medford or Haddon Heights?
- The average commute for residents of Medford is 4.7 minutes longer than it is for residents of Haddon Heights.

Things to do in Medford?
Medford is an incorporated borough situated within Burlington County, New Jersey offering plenty of activities such as exploring its multiple parks convenienty situated close by plus nearby Kristman Wildlife Preserve features amazing views ideal for outdoor activities.
